After reaching Finland
Step 1: Get a sim card from any R kioski in airport,
railway station, bus station or anywhere.
Step 2: There is a second-hand shops in all cities of Finland if you need some furniture/home utensils, electronic and electrical appliances etc at a very cheap price. Check my video: • Best second hand shops...
Step 3: Go and register at the municipality (dvv.fi) as you already have an appointment. If you could not book an appointment before coming, do as soon as possible (call them) and register yourself.
Step 4: As you register in the municipality, immediately call to the tax office (029 512000) and order your tax card at your home address.
Step 5: Call op bank (www.op.fi/) to get an appointment to open an account. Tell them that “you already applied for the personal ID card but it will take time. You can open in other bank as well
Step 6: As you receive the bank account number and tax card, immediately send it to HR or your university etc.
Step 8: Go to police station and apply for Finnish ID card or personal id card.

step 9: After getting this personal ID card issued by police, you need to go again to your bank and they will activate the bank ID/internet banking.
Step 10: Now using your bank ID to log in to Kela.fi (social security department of Finland) and apply for a Kela card. You can also apply without internet banking.

    Just a small correction personal ID card isn't necessary for the basic internet banking, it's just normally required if you wish to use your bank credentials to identify yourself electronically. Which allows you to login and handle most things with Finnish government offices online without face-to-face visits. I've met foreigners who have been worried about not being able to use the internet banking before getting their personal identity card, but this hasn't been the case in any of the banks in Finland that I know of. So to transfer funds to your home country or to receive as well as to pay your bills online will be possible before you receive the Police issued personal identity card.
